I have a 3.5cc outboard (model number 8907) and need to order some propellers for shipment to Australia. I was also wondering if I should order a new flex shaft and/or flex shaft housing at same time in anticipation of wear. There is not much talk about replacing them - are they prone to wear if clean and well lubed ?

I used to race competitively with the K&B 3.5cc outboard in IMPBA Distric 1 years ago and never once had a flex shaft failure. The Teflon tubes did show some wear eventually but also never failed for me. I suppose it all depends on how much you'll be using the motor and whether or not getting replacements is an issue. I think I still have my new in the bag spare flex cables.
